Albemarle County surrounds or includes the city of Charlottesville, several towns, and many named communities and neighborhoods. Using a combination of volunteer and career personnel, Charlottesville and Albemarle separately provide fire, rescue, and law enforcement services to their citizens. With property in both the city and county, the University of Virginia (UVA) has its own police department, security force, ambulance fleet, and is home to the Pegasus medevac helicopter. All of these agencies work together regularly under mutual aid agreements.

Emergent 911-calls, and non-emergent service calls, are received by, and dispatched centrally from, the local Emergency Communications Center. The UVA Medical Center and Martha Jefferson Hospitals serve citizens in this and surrounding counties. UVA Medcom dispatches UVA's ambulance fleet and Pegasus. UVA Medic V (read as "Medic 5") ambulances primarily serve UVA medical facilities. UVA Special Event Medical Management (SEMM) ambulances primarily provide standby support at special events involving large crowds. Several area rescue squads also provide standby support. Specialized teams, like the Technical Rescue Team, utilize a combination of personnel and resources from several agencies. Other specialized fire and rescue teams, some agency-specific, include: Water Rescue Teams, Vehicle Rescue Teams, and Special Event Teams. Several agencies are members of Virginia State EMS Task Force 2.

In the city and county, the police departments handle patrol and traffic duties, whereas the sheriff departments handle civil matters, court duties, and long-distance prisoner transports. The sheriff departments regularly support the police on special assignments like selected traffic enforcement. All of the above agencies, and the Virginia State Police, combine their efforts using a unified command structure when an event involves large crowds, increased traffic, or requires a larger combined response. Specialized law-enforcement teams include: Tactical Teams, K-9 Teams, Firearms Teams, Surveillance Teams, Crisis Negotiations Teams, Forensics Teams, Accident Reconstruction Teams, and Search and Rescue Teams. The multi-jurisdictional Jefferson Area Drug Enforcement (JADE) Task Force utilizes members and resources from many of the above law enforcement agencies, and can also include members of the Virginia State Police and federal agencies like the FBI and DEA as appropriate.

The Albemarle, Charlottesville, and UVA communities are home to the U.S. Army's National Ground Intelligence Center, the U.S. Army's Judge Advocate General's Legal Center and School, part of the Defense Intelligence Agency, a National Guard armory, and U.S. Army Reserve Advising Group. UVA is home to a Naval Reserve Officer's Training Corps (NROTC) Midshipment Battalion, the Army Reserve Officer's Training Corps (AROTC) Cavalier Battalion, and the Air Force Officer's Training Corps (AFROTC) Detachment 890.
